Posted: Fri May 08, 2009 8:47 am
by dirtygalant
probably best to find a complete van with a busted motor and then rip out all the conversion parts like pedals, column shifter, clutch master, linkages, gearbox, flywheel etc etc. If you get all that stuff individually from a wrecker or junk yard it will all start to add up. I'll keep my eyes peeled over here.
